Fried Apples with Curry
Ingredients List
- 4 Apples (Granny Smith are
- -best; but any can do.)
- 1 md Yellow onion; sliced
- -thin
- 3 tb Butter
- 1 tb Curry powder
- Salt & pepper to taste
Directions
This is a great side dish or relish for any kind of meat course. The
flavor is mild but sweet, and the curry sets the natural sugar of the
apples.
Core and wedge the apples with an apple/pear corer-cutter, or do the same
by hand. Heat a frying pan and saut”š the onions with the butter until they
are clear. Add the apples and saut”š until the apples are not quite tender.
Add the seasonings and toss.
